Plan on roughly 238 to 242 minutes door to door, depending on when you travel. Off-peak departures — early morning or midday — tend to hold near the lower end, since the Turnpike runs freely between Miami and the Orlando area. Peak windows around weekday rush hours and busy holiday weekends push the trip toward the upper end, adding only a few minutes across a journey of 235.5 miles (379.1 km). Because the fare is flat, that variance never changes what you pay; a slower day simply means a little more time in a climate-controlled vehicle, not a higher bill. Disney’s Polynesian Village Resort is a South Seas–themed property set along a lagoon within the Walt Disney World area, a short hop from the parks by Disney’s own transportation. The grounds carry a tropical, island vibe — palm-lined walkways, a longhouse-style lobby, and waterfront views — and the resort itself is the destination, so most guests spend their days at the theme parks and evenings back at the property. The surrounding district is built for visitors: family dining, lakeside paths, and easy connections toward the Magic Kingdom side of the resort area.
